An architecture for a machine learning system machine. See more ideas about concept diagram, diagram and concept architecture. Why is architecture difficult, and how can diagrams help. The small set of abstractions and diagram types makes the c4 model. Wiggins submitted to the department of architecture on 11 may 1989 in partial fulfillment of the requirements of the degree master of science in architecture studies abstract the act of designing in architecture is a complex process. The center is the use case view which connects all these four. First, the criteria for realizing buildings are intrinsically. Design and implementation of airline reservation web. The next step is to create a toolbox for each diagram type in the dynamic requirements framework. Hence, the same elements as used in design are also used to support this.
The eshoponweb reference application uses the clean architecture approach in organizing its code into projects. Thus the rise of the diagram, as opposed to the model or the drawing, is the one of the most significant new developments in the process of design in the late 20th and early 21st centuries. I was cautioned that the book was written primarily for firstyear architecture. In late june, i had the pleasure of attending a workshop called the first draft is the easy part with author and coach stuart horwitz. It can help you know more about agile methodology quickly. Its almost a common understanding of using diagrams to explain the design concept. The togaf standard, a standard of the open group, is a proven enterprise architecture methodology and framework used by the worlds leading organizations to improve business efficiency.
Our top 10 architecture design books, architectural concept books and. Through a close scrutiny of existing literature, incorporation of personal experience as an architect, and testing of theories with lay, novice, and expert designers a theory of design methodology is proposed. Net core on the ardaliscleanarchitecture github repository. Aug 18, 2014 in late june, i had the pleasure of attending a workshop called the first draft is the easy part with author and coach stuart horwitz. Structurizr is a collection of tooling to help you visualise, document and explore your software architecture. The data flow diagram dfd is a structured analysis and design method. The latter name, clean architecture, is used as the name for this architecture in this e book. Methods for architectural composition 20, by jeffrey balmer and michael t. Easily share your publications and get them in front of issuus. Based on a minimal universal ontology of stateful objects and processes that transform them, opm can be used to formally specify the function, structure, and behavior of artificial and natural systems in a large variety of domains. Sep 18, 20 this methodology defines an architecture development lifecycle, its phases and processes of managing the architecture development, and can be used in conjunction with other frameworks.
A use case represents the functionality of the system. Architects today do not use the glossy photographs of magazines in the same way that nineteenthcentury architects mobilized the drawings in the grand folios. The zachman framework is an enterprise ontology and is a fundamental structure for enterprise architecture which provides a formal and structured way of viewing and defining an enterprise. The architecture of diagrams by andrew chaplin issuu. The design of architectural form by peter eisenman and rem koolhaas, publisher. Rather, they are working with knowledge that is largely tacit. Organize and revise any manuscript with the book architecture method, was named one of 20s best books on writing by the writer magazine. Aug 01, 2008 it architecture diagrams ii recommended format and notation august 1, 2008 posted by chris eaton in communications, it architecture, methodology, methods, sap. Diagrams of architecture is the first anthology to. You might know him from his books delirious new york or s, m, l, xl and his practice from the cctv hq, casa da musica in porto or the central library in seattle.
Wiggins submitted to the department of architecture on 11 may 1989 in partial fulfillment of the requirements of the degree master of science in architecture studies abstract the act of designing in architecture. This methodology required defining all aspects of the va enterprise from a business process, data, technical, location, personnel, and requirements perspective. The open group architecture framework togaf is an enterprise architecture methodology that offers a highlevel framework for enterprise software development. Conceptual diagrams in creative architectural practice 4 which we classify as a particular type of diagram and call a. Common web application architectures microsoft docs. An excellent beginners guide to information architecture. There have been several attempts at aligning business strategy to technology8 but most have failed as the traceability from business to architecture to delivery to management has been at best weak and normally nonexistent. Object process methodology opm is a conceptual modeling language and methodology for capturing knowledge and designing systems, specified as isopas 19450. Use a diagram template to lead your client through a process. Ibm filenet p8 platform and architecture april 2011 international technical support organization sg24766701. Advanced system analysis on automated library management system.
The methods described are translated through clear and simple diagrams and architectural. However, it is more than simply showing the audience to help them understand the idea. Because the application core doesnt depend on infrastructure, its very easy to write automated unit tests for this layer. The first critical, multidisciplinary book on the history, theory and futures of the architectural diagram. Form, space, and order has served as the classic introduction to the basic vocabulary of architectural design the updated and revised fourth edition features the fundamental elements of space and form and is designed to. Previously, we have called attention to this class of diagrams in cognitivehistorical analyses of several case studies in the history of science. The whitepaper explores five core principles of business architecture. The methods described are translated through clear and simple diagrams and. As with analysis and design patterns, you should follow the practice apply patterns gently introduce them into your. As shown in omas exhibition at the aa, besides an architecture firm, oma is also a massive book production machine, where they use books in all stages of the design process, such as documenting. Complex thinking processes are viewed as an interaction between three types of. Book architecture method the practice of creativity. No doubt that reading is the simplest way for humans to derive and constructing meaning in order to gain a particular knowledge from a source. An azure diagram template for an azure site recovery architecture diagram and microsoft azure network shapes.
Uml component diagram is used to support the implementation perspective. Based on interesting diagrams and drawings, peter eisenman. The following diagram reflects processe s of conscious and unconscious inspiration am ong architecture. Organize and revise any manuscript with the book architecture method and was planning on buying it as it looked like a unique approach to revising. Conceptual diagrams in creative architectural practice. You can use it as a flowchart maker, network diagram software, to create uml online, as an er diagram tool, to design database schema, to build bpmn online, as a circuit diagram. Its an implementation of the c4 model and allows you to create software architecture models using code or a browserbased ui, along with supplementary documentation using markdownasciidoc. In the final configuration, each element acquired a double meaning, at once representing the. Create professional flowcharts, process maps, uml models, org charts, and er diagrams using our templates. They must be self descriptive, consistent, accurate enough and connected to the code. Patternoriented software architecture is an excellent place to start learning about common architectural patterns such as layers, pipes and filters, broker, modelviewcontroller, and blackboard. This thesis attempts to demystify the process of architectural design. Organize and revise any manuscript with the book architecture. Event driven solution implementation methodology in this article we are presenting an end to end set of activities to run a successful minimum viable product for an eventdriven solution using cloud native microservices and event backbone as the core technology approach.
The decentralisation of blockchain architecture is the sole credit of the p2p network that it is built on. But if youre after a gift, you might want to see some curated. If youre looking for new shoes for a wedding, you might want to filter by style and by color. Architecture framework design with enterprise architect. The way all these copies of a single ledger is synchronized is due to a consensus algorithm. A comparison of the top four enterprisearchitecture. This approach embraces the devops mindset, allowing the architecture of a system to evolve continuously over time, while simultaneously supporting the needs of current users. Discover delightful childrens books with prime book box, a subscription that delivers new books every 1, 2, or 3. Rem koolhaas designing the design process sjors timmer.
This taxonomy aims to exhibit a framework of different types of diagrams categorised. Now that we have explored how our machine learning system might work in the context of moviestream, we can outline a possible architecture for our system. Diagram is one of the most used words in contemporary architecture and urban design. A customizable agile methodology template is here for free download and printing.
Issuu is a digital publishing platform that makes it simple to publish magazines, catalogs, newspapers, books, and more online. These free diagram templates utilize colors, infographics, and unique designs to vividly communicate your story. The c4 model is an abstractionfirst approach to diagramming software architecture, based upon abstractions that reflect how software architects and developers think about and build software. We conclude section 5 with a brief discussion of some desiderata for computational support for thinking with diagrams in design. I had already checked out his new book blueprint your bestseller. Architectural diagrams must be self descriptive, consistent, accurate enough and connected. A history of modern architecture as a discursive practice. Consider the principles in the agile manifesto, involve team members who will be using the architecture in its development, and reflect and adapt often, and you will end up with an architecture. So before you create your next presentation, check out microsoft diagram templates. Implementation defines the components assembled together to make a complete physical system. Rem koolhaas studied scriptwriting and architecture and is heading omaamo, an office he cofounded in 1975.
When thinking about information architecture, its important to think about the different users and how they will navigate, search, or use filters. Its purpose is to provide a structured but flexible process that transforms requirements into specifications, architectures, and configuration baselines. Architecture threetier layer is a clientserver architecture in which the user interface, business process business rules. Diagrams in architecture education and practice many books for architecture. The architecture of diagrams a taxonomy of architectural diagrams compiled by andrew chaplin. Pay ticket the detailed design of services are being described in service model diagram. This tendency has been digitized when books evolve into digital media equivalent e books. This book is useful those students who offer the research methodology at post graduation and m. In the visual language of architecture, diagrams are the dot points. Five core principles of successful business architecture. The text provides a thorough, howto explanation of each of the. Ssadm diagram software structured systems analysis and. An agile approach to software architecture agileconnection. Manal osama khalil 2 1 associate professor architecture department college of engineeringtanta.
Moviestreams future architecture as we can see, our system incorporates the machine learning pipeline outlined in the preceding diagram. Diagram templates and examples with hundreds of template examples to choose from, you can start diagramming in no time. Agile architecture is a set of values, practices, and collaborations that support the active, evolutionary design and architecture of a system. I was expecting a book full of diagrams similar to those on the cover.
Since the 1980s, the diagram has become a preferred method for researching, communicating, theorising and making architectural designs, ideas and projects. Instructions and demonstrations help you to complete the simple architecture. The cornerstone of intel architecture s popularity is its compatibility. There are more than 50 predefined templates to get you started in various categories. Uml provides class diagram, object diagram to support this. Design of a system consists of classes, interfaces, and collaboration. The zachman framework methodology has for example been used by the united states department of veterans affairs va to develop and maintain its oneva enterprise architecture in 2001. Sep 06, 2016 for all dignified enterprise and other architects out there. Hence, other perspectives are connected with use case. Lucidchart is your solution for visual communication and crossplatform collaboration. It was developed in the uk by cct central computer and telecommunications agency in the early 1980s.
How to create application architecture diagram online. The following shows our drf diagrams profile, as modeled in enterprise architect. This week we bring to you some best architecture books. It is the most prominent and reliable enterprise architecture standard, ensuring consistent standards, methods, and communication among enterprise.
For more than forty years, the beautifully illustrated architecture. In my search for precedent publications that discuss how to utilize diagramming in architecture, a professor friend of mine suggested i read diagramming the big idea. Creating new diagram types in enterprise architect. Freehand drawing input, as opposed to structured diagram entry and editing. Architectural diagrams can be useful tools for documenting and communicating the design of a system. The systems engineering process is the heart of systems engineering management. Post facto explications describe design aspects after. A good design process or methodology defines a consistent, repeatable set of steps to employ when working to expose a serverside service component as an accessible, usable web api. Data flow diagram comprehensive guide with examples. Net core architecture diagram following clean architecture. See more ideas about design process, concept architecture and architecture. A methodology for service architectures a good start not just for an architecture, but also for business strategy. Agile methodology free agile methodology templates. It is traditional visual representation of the information flows within a system.
Figures 510 and 511 show how tests fit into this architecture. The systems engineering tutorial starts with a sysml project containing artifacts for an outdoor spa pool temperature controller. Agile model driven development with uml 2 is an important reference book for agile modelers, describing how to develop 35 types of agile models including all uml 2 diagrams. Maintaining spatial relations among elements as the diagram is. Thus the rise of the diagram, as opposed to the model or the drawing. Conceptual diagrams in creative architectural practice 19 meanings attached to these perceptual features. Post facto explications describe design aspects after the design. Design process for the private residence, sixth edition, covers the fundamentals of residential design. In a typical blockchain architecture, every individual node in a network maintains a local copy of blockchain. This methodology defines an architecture development lifecycle, its phases and processes of managing the architecture development, and can be used in conjunction with other frameworks. This week we bring to you some best architecture books that are available for free online, you may download more.
It architecture diagrams ii recommended format and notation. Apr 27, 2015 stuarts first book, blueprint your bestseller. You can find a solution template you can use as a starting point for your own asp. For an organization transitioning to agile development, creating software architecture isnt incompatible with your new processes. Introduction structured systems analysis and design methodology ssadm ssadm structured systems analysis and design method is another method dealing with information systems design.
932 768 1188 1421 1616 532 1474 324 716 877 1486 839 121 966 769 236 685 1594 890 534 10 1503 675 646 1276 1236 1340 800 1172 7 403 304 652 1641 1422 3 129 1028 1117 755 525 1131 106 952 1191 1226